Lobster Tail Recipe Air Fryer: Perfectly Cooked in 10 Minutes

This air fryer lobster tail recipe yields perfectly cooked lobster tails that are juicy, tender, and full of flavor in just minutes!


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 lobster tails
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• Chopped f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Preheat your air fryer to 380°F (193°C).
  2. Using kitchen shears, carefully cut the top shell of the lobster tail lengthwise, stopping just before the tail fins.
  3. Gently pull apart the shell and expose the lobster meat. You can lift the meat slightly out of the shell for a better presentation.
  4. In a small bowl, mix together melted butter, minced garlic, paprika, salt, black pepper, and lemon juice.
  5. Brush the garlic butter mixture generously over the lobster meat.
  6. Place the lobster tails in the air fryer basket, meat side up, and cook for 6-8 minutes, or until the lobster meat is opaque and reaches an internal temperature of 140°F (60°C).
  7. Once cooked, remove the lobster tails from the air fryer and brush with any remaining garlic butter.
  8. Garnish with chopped parsley and serve immediately.

Notes

  • Cooking time may vary based on the size of the lobster tails. Larger tails may require additional cooking time.
  • Do not overcook the lobster, as it can become tough and rubbery.
